On 08/01/17 15:14, Kern Sibbald wrote:
> Hello Phil,
> 
> There should be no difference in how Bacula handles tapes between 7.4.7 
> and 9.0.x.  If there is I would suggest that you carefully document it 
> in a way that I can "see" the problem and easily reproduce it so that I 
> can fix it.  mtx-changer will *not* work unless you have an 
> autochanger.  There is no fake autochanger for tapes.  There are two 
> types of "fake" autochangers for Disks.  The first one is something like 
> mhvtl that is a program that simulates in detail and autochanger.  The 
> second is the Bacula virtual disk autochanger.


I did already report this finding in detail in my test reports in
bacula-devel.  If it SHOULD work, I will revert my configuration and
re-test.

What I found was that a tape could be read and written in a standalone
drive if already mounted when the SD was started, but could not be
mounted or unmounted except by stopping the SD and manually using mt.
Running the SD at -d 200, it appeared the SD never received the
mount/unmount commands.

The 'fake autochanger' workaround was suggested by Ana Arruda, who said:

"I don't remember in what version the old tape drive configuration in
bacula-dir.conf as a stand alone storage device was causing the
mount/unmount bconsole commands to do nothing and this is the workaround
we have to make it work."
